[发明专利]基于教育网络信息主题采集方法在审
申请号: | 201811571567.9 | 申请日: | 2018-12-21 |
公开(公告)号: | CN109670099A | 公开(公告)日: | 2019-04-23 |
发明(设计)人: | 陈炽昌;杨帆 | 申请(专利权)人: | 全通教育集团(广东)股份有限公司 |
主分类号: | G06F16/951 | 分类号: | G06F16/951;G06F16/955 |
代理公司: | 成都玖和知识产权代理事务所(普通合伙) 51238 | 代理人: | 胡琳梅 |
地址: | 528403 广东省中山市东区*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 采集 教育网络 信息主题 去重 页面 网络页面 网页保存 网页文本 页面信息 信息库 采集器 放入 去除 下载 网页 分析 教育 | ||
1.基于教育网络信息主题采集方法,其特征在于,包括以下步骤:
S1、首先构造主题类缓冲池positivePool、非主题类缓冲池negtivePool两类缓冲池,用来存放UR类实体,即URL地址集中的URL地址;两个缓冲池初始化值均为空集合;
所述主题类缓冲池中存放与采集主题相关的URL地址,非主题类缓冲池中存放与采集主题不相关的URL地址;
缓冲池的作用是存放URL地址以便采集网页的时候能快速使用,分为主题类和非主题类是为了形成主题类的URL地址集;所述缓冲池即为封装好的队列操作;
S2、根据需要采集的主题人工选取种子站点,构成搜索程序Spider的初始网页集即URL地址集;
S3、对Web网页的教育网络信息主题进行Spider采集;
S4、对采集到的网络页面进行解析下载;提取页面的URL地址以及文本信息;对采集到的网络页面进行与主题的相关性计算;过滤掉与主题无关的网络页面;对采集到的页面URL地址,进行相关性计算;过滤掉与主题无关的URL地址;
S5、将过滤后与主题相关的页面放入到主题数据库,将与主题不相关的页面放入到非主题数据库;将采集到的与主题相关的URL地址存放到主题类缓冲池;
S6、对主题数据库中的网页进行去重处理;删除主题数据库中相同的页面;并且对主题类缓冲池内的URL地址进行去重处理;
S7、提取主题数据库中去重后页面的URL地址;将提取到的URL地址添加到去重后主题类缓冲池内的URL地址序列中,并且进行去重处理;将去重处理后的URL地址序列存储到主题类缓冲池,将去重处理后的网页存储到基于教育主题的教育信息库。
2.如权利要求1所述的基于教育网络信息主题采集方法,其特征在于:在步骤S3中还包括步骤:结合定点策略、缓冲池策略,记录对应页面地址;该模块记录的页面地址最后全部提供给采集模块进行页面的采集;所述定点策略为只对人工选定的站点进行站内搜索;所述缓冲池策略为把采集的页面地址放入缓冲池。
3.如权利要求2所述的基于教育网络信息主题采集方法,其特征在于:在步骤S6和S7中采用哈希表对URL地址序列进行去重;
将所有的URL地址存储到hashmap容器中,然后通过strhash函数计算URL的hash值;
根据计算得到的URL的hash值在hashmap容器查找,如果该hash值已经存在,则删除该URL地址。
4.如权利要求3所述的基于教育网络信息主题采集方法,其特征在于:步骤S4中首先分别设置页面相关性和URL相关性的阀值,采用基于语义的向量空间模型方法进行页面相关性计算;通过pagerank算法对URL相关性进行计算;将相关性小于阀值的页面和URL删除。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于全通教育集团(广东)股份有限公司,未经全通教育集团(广东)股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201811571567.9/1.html,转载请声明来源钻瓜专利网。
- 上一篇:基于大数据技术的行业对标实现方法
- 下一篇:一种页面数据抓取方法及装置